Let the two puppies be A and B respectively.
Translating the word problem into an algebraic expression, we have;
A + B = 22kg 300g
A = 9kg 500g
Conversion;
1 Kilograms = 1000 grams.
9kg 500g = 9*1000 + 500 = 9500 grams
22kg 300g = 22*1000 + 300 = 22300 g
Substituting into the above formula, we have;
9500 + B = 22300
B = 22300 - 9500
B = 12800 grams or 12kg 800 grams

Two complementary angles add up to 90 degrees. Hence, the problem can be set up and solved.
